    Method and system for sensing water, debris or other extraneous objects on a display screen

    Abstract: A computing device includes a housing and a display assembly having a screen. The housing at least partially circumvents the screen so that the screen is viewable and a set of touch sensors are provided with the display assembly. A processor is provided within the housing to detect a plurality of interactions with the set of touch sensors. The processor further determines, based on the plurality of interactions, a presence of extraneous objects on a surface of the screen of the display assembly. More specifically, the processor may determine that the screen is wet if three or more interactions are detected, concurrently, via the set of touch sensors and/or a contact duration associated with each of the plurality of interactions exceeds a threshold duration.

    Device with a mid-frame structure and reverse draft

    Abstract: An electronic reading device includes a mid-frame structure such that the mid-frame structure can include a reverse draft. A reverse draft corresponds to a back of the electronic reading device being a predetermined amount wider than a front of the electronic reading device. Additionally, a co-molded mid-frame stiffener provides a predetermined rigidity of the electronic reading device. The electronic reading device also includes a display integrated with the front of the mid-frame structure, wherein a space between the display and the mid-frame structure includes one or more electronic reading device components. Similarly, a back cover is integrated with the back of the mid-frame structure, wherein a space between the back cover and the mid-frame structure includes additional electronic reading device components.

    Method and system for mobile device splash mode operation and transition thereto

    Abstract: A computing device includes a housing and a display assembly having a screen. The housing at least partially circumvents the screen so that the screen is viewable and a set of touch sensors are provided with the display assembly. A processor is provided within the housing to detect a gesture via the set of touch sensors, and to interpret the gesture as one of a plurality of user inputs. The processor further detects a presence of extraneous objects on a surface the screen of the display assembly, and adjusts one or more settings of the computing device in response to detecting the presence of extraneous objects. For example, the processor may adjust the one or more settings by reconfiguring a set of actions to be performed in response to the plurality of user inputs.
